Airblue has hinted at expanding its international routes with a new destination in Saudi Arabia. In a teaser posted on its official Facebook page, the airline wrote:
“Something exciting is about to take off! Can you guess where we’re flying next?”
The post further added, “Doors are open to a new destination. Guess where?”
This announcement quickly gained traction among travelers on social media, sparking widespread curiosity about Airblue’s next move.
Clues Point Toward Dammam
Airblue dropped an additional clue, describing the new route as heading to “a city that shines on the eastern edge of Saudi Arabia.”
This strong hint suggests that Dammam, a major Saudi Arabian city along the Arabian Gulf, is the new destination.
Dammam serves as a key economic, industrial, and cultural hub, making it an ideal addition to Airblue’s expanding route network.
Boosting Pakistan–Saudi Arabia Air Connectivity
The expected Dammam route will strengthen air travel between Pakistan and Saudi Arabia, serving a large population of Pakistani expatriates living and working in the Kingdom.
It will also cater to business travelers and religious pilgrims, offering more direct flight options and enhancing overall connectivity.
